In today’s rapidly evolving technological landscape, businesses must continually adapt to remain competitive. Hiring a tech consulting company can be a strategic move to enhance operational efficiency, implement innovative solutions, and drive digital transformation. However, selecting the right consulting partner is crucial for success.
This article outlines best practices for hiring tech consulting companies, ensuring you make informed decisions that align with your business goals.
Define Your Needs and Objectives
Before embarking on the hiring process, clearly define your business needs and objectives.
Ask yourself:
- What specific challenges do we face?
- Are we looking for short-term solutions or long-term partnerships?
- What outcomes do we expect from this collaboration?
Creating a detailed project scope will help you communicate your needs effectively and ensure that potential consultants understand your expectations.
Key Takeaway:
Establish a clear understanding of your objectives to facilitate a targeted search for the right consulting firm.
Research Potential Candidates
Once you’ve defined your needs, start researching potential tech consulting companies.
Use the following methods to gather information:
- Online Reviews and Ratings: Platforms like Clutch, G2, and Google Reviews provide insights into a firm’s reputation.
- Case Studies and Portfolios: Examine their past projects to assess their expertise and the industries they have worked with.
- Referrals and Recommendations: Ask colleagues or industry peers for recommendations based on their experiences.
Key Takeaway:
Conduct thorough research to create a shortlist of tech consulting firms that align with your business needs.
Evaluate Expertise and Experience
When narrowing down your options, assess the expertise and experience of the consulting firms.
Look for:
- Technical Proficiency: Ensure the firm has expertise in the technologies relevant to your project, such as cloud computing, AI, or cybersecurity.
- Industry Experience: A firm with experience in your specific industry will understand the unique challenges and regulations you face.
- Certifications and Partnerships: Look for certifications and partnerships with leading technology providers, which can indicate a firm’s credibility and knowledge.
Key Takeaway:
Choose a consulting company that has a proven track record in your industry and the technical skills necessary for your project.
Assess Their Approach and Methodology
Different consulting companies have varying approaches to problem-solving and project management. Evaluate their methodology to ensure it aligns with your expectations.
Key considerations include:
- Project Management: Inquire about their project management techniques and tools. Are they Agile, Waterfall, or a hybrid approach?
- Collaboration Style: Understand how they collaborate with clients. Do they prefer regular updates, feedback loops, or open communication?
- Customization: Ensure they are willing to tailor their services to meet your specific needs rather than offering one-size-fits-all solutions.
Key Takeaway:
Select a firm that employs a methodology compatible with your organization’s culture and project requirements.
Analyze Cost and Value
Budget is often a significant factor when hiring tech consulting companies. While it’s essential to consider costs, focus on the value you will receive.
Key points to consider include:
- Pricing Structure: Understand their pricing model—hourly rates, fixed fees, or retainer agreements.
- Return on Investment (ROI): Evaluate how the proposed solutions will impact your bottom line. Consider potential cost savings, increased efficiency, or revenue growth.
- Long-term Value: Consider the long-term benefits of working with a consulting firm, including support, training, and ongoing maintenance.
Key Takeaway:
Balance cost with the potential value the consulting firm can bring to your organization.
Check References and Past Work
Before finalizing your decision, ask for references from past clients. Speaking directly with previous clients can provide valuable insights into the firm’s performance and reliability.
Key questions to ask include:
- How well did the consulting firm understand your needs?
- Were they able to deliver on time and within budget?
- How effective was their communication throughout the project?
Additionally, review their portfolio to assess the quality of their work and the outcomes achieved for other clients.
Key Takeaway:
Verifying references and reviewing past work can help you gauge the firm’s ability to meet your expectations.
Consider Cultural Fit
Cultural alignment between your organization and the consulting firm can significantly influence the success of your collaboration. A good cultural fit fosters better communication, understanding, and cooperation. Consider:
- Values and Mission: Ensure their values align with yours. A shared mission can lead to a more harmonious working relationship.
- Team Dynamics: Assess how the consulting team collaborates internally and how they might fit into your organization’s existing teams.
- Work Style: Consider their approach to work and whether it complements your organization’s culture.
Key Takeaway:
A strong cultural fit can enhance collaboration and project outcomes.
Clarify Roles and Responsibilities
Once you’ve chosen a consulting firm, it’s crucial to clarify roles and responsibilities from the outset. Establish a clear governance structure that outlines:
- Key Stakeholders: Identify the main points of contact from both your organization and the consulting firm.
- Decision-Making Processes: Define how decisions will be made and who has the authority to make them.
- Performance Metrics: Establish key performance indicators (KPIs) to measure the success of the project.
Key Takeaway:
Clear roles and responsibilities ensure accountability and facilitate smooth project execution.
- Foster Open Communication
Effective communication is critical to the success of any consulting engagement. Foster an environment of open communication by:
- Regular Updates: Schedule regular check-ins to discuss progress, challenges, and feedback.
- Transparency: Encourage transparency about project status, budget, and timelines to build trust.
- Feedback Loops: Implement mechanisms for both teams to provide and receive feedback throughout the project.
Key Takeaway:
Open communication can help identify issues early and keep the project on track.
- Prepare for Transition and Knowledge Transfer
Finally, prepare for a smooth transition once the project is completed. Plan for knowledge transfer to ensure your team can maintain and build upon the solutions implemented.
Key steps include:
Documentation: Ensure comprehensive documentation of processes, technologies, and any custom solutions developed.
- Training: Request training sessions for your team to become proficient in the new systems and technologies.
- Post-Project Support: Discuss options for ongoing support and maintenance to address any issues that may arise after project completion.
Key Takeaway:
A well-planned transition can maximize the long-term benefits of your collaboration with the consulting firm.
Conclusion
Hiring a tech consulting company is a significant decision that can profoundly impact your organization’s success. By following these best practices—defining your needs, researching candidates, evaluating expertise, assessing costs, checking references, and fostering communication—you can select a consulting partner that aligns with your business objectives and drives innovation. Remember, the right tech consulting firm can not only solve your immediate challenges but also help you navigate the future of technology with confidence.